American born, Erik Weihenmayer, is probably the world’s most accomplished blind mountaineer, with a vast array of achievements including an ascent of Mount Everest along with the seven other high points of the different continents.
In 2021, along with his good friend, Timmy O’Neil, and chairman of our Heritage Collection, Mick Tighe, Erik came to Scotland for a sea stack climbing expedition. It was a huge success with ascents of The Old Man of Stoer(Lochinver), Yesnaby Castle(Orkney) and the Old Man Of Hoy.
Having climbed Everest in 2001, Erik still had a couple of oxygen cylinders from the expedition in his store, one of which he kindly donated to us.
It is signed by many if the expedition members and it is a wonderful addition to our collection - extending it across the ranges.
